Its a '57 Maserati 2000 GS Spyder that was in a concours I participated in a few months ago. I've seen it several times, but am always amazed by the little details.

http://forums.pelicanparts.com/uploa...1131118421.jpg

One of 12 built, alloy bodied by Frua. A quite stunning car in person.
